Ticket: Config drift causing flaky integration tests — Payrora

Payrora's integration suite fails intermittently because staging config drifted from what the tests assume: retry counts and timeout values were hand-edited in March and never committed. Fix is to pin the suite to a checked-in config and alert on drift. Flagging for the sync since it blocks the release train. Current drifted staging values are below.

deployment values, kajep-kageg:
[praix]
host = praix.paliqcorp.corp
user = praix_svc
database = praix_prod

Welcome aboard. Our serverless handlers on the Fenwick platform incur cold starts of 800ms–2s when a new worker is provisioned. Most of that time goes to loading the Ormscale runtime and establishing the initial database session. We mitigate this with a warm pool of four pre-initialized workers per region, refreshed hourly. During your first week, you'll mostly touch the handler in `ingest-tally`, which reads pricing rows at startup. For local testing against the staging database, use the connection string below.

primary connection of tawif-yajeg = postgresql://rusiel_svc:G879q9cx6GsSvj@db-dd9f.norvagrid.internal:5432/casath

# Approvals — TilePloy Map-Tile Prefetcher

TilePloy prefetches map tiles for the Wayfarer app based on predicted routes. Any change to prefetch radius, cache eviction, or upstream tile quotas requires written approval, since misconfiguration can exhaust bandwidth budgets overnight. Submit changes through the standard review queue and obtain sign-off from the responsible maintainer named below.

signatory, tageg-hahof: Ralion Kelion Fraael

Finance Review Summary — Annual Billing Transition

Vellmark's shift from monthly to annual billing for the Corvane platform completed its second quarter. Cash collected upfront rose 34%, and deferred revenue now stands at 2.1x the prior-year level. Churn among converted accounts fell slightly, though discounting on annual plans averaged 11%, above the 8% target. Finance should model the discount drag into Q3 forecasts and flag any contract exceptions above threshold. Leadership has shared additional context for planning purposes below.

confidential, kagup-bafog: Fraaxax Group is in early talks to buy Soroxox Group for about $343.8 million. The Olidor launch date is June 14, and nothing goes to the press before then. Legal wants the Aldmirek Logistics term sheet signed before July 23.